The seals for this pistol are as follows:-
BS006 Valve stem tip
BS008 Valve plug
BS009 Breech
BS117 Piston ( tighter fit than the original 2.5mm x 20mm)

It was the valve pin that had moved which caused the problem of not firing. Punching the pin back to the correct position and re-tightening the set screw solved the problem.
